Nestled in the stunning landscape of Fife, Burntisland train station is a gateway not only to the charming town itself but also to the wider region composed of captivating attractions and destinations in Scotland. Primarily a stop on the Fife Circle Line, this station offers travelers a unique blend of scenic beauty and practicality.
When at Burntisland, you'll find that the ticket buying and collection facilities are adequately equipped to accommodate your needs. The ticket office operates limited hours during weekdays and Saturdays, but worry not—ticket machines are available to simplify your travel experiences. Most importantly, online ticket buyers can easily retrieve their tickets at these machines.
While Burntisland station may not boast an extensive range of shops or dining options—no refreshment facilities or ATMs can be found here—it does offer a variety of essential services to ensure a seamless experience for passengers. Staff help and customer information are available during certain weekday and Saturday hours, with help points placed conveniently around the station for your ease.
The station features step-free access on certain platforms, although travelers should note that the ramps and footbridge make it a Category B3 station. An induction loop is available, but you'd need to bear in mind the absence of amenities like accessible toilets, accessible taxis, and a proper pickup/drop-off point for passengers with reduced mobility.
Entwining with various modes of transport can be crucial for your travel itinerary, and Burntisland offers several options. Opt for the rail replacement bus service conveniently located at the top of Harbour Place if necessary, or check out the bus services via Traveline Scotland. The station offers links to taxis via the Train Taxi service for those looking for flexible and direct options.

Nestled in the vibrant heart of East London, London Fields train station is a pivotal node in the city's bustling transport network. While the station itself might seem understated, it serves as a gateway to both local attractions and a myriad of popular spots across the city. Whether you're a local commuter or a visitor eager to explore London's bustling streets, London Fields offers a convenient starting point for your journey.
London Fields station is committed to making your travel experience smooth and convenient. Although there is no ticket office at the station, ticket machines are readily available to ensure you can collect pre-booked tickets with ease. For those who require assistance, the station also offers acc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and step-free access to make navigation straightforward for everyone. While there's no waiting room, there is a convenient seating area for those short stops or while waiting for your train.
Although amenities like refreshment facilities and shops aren't available within the station, the surrounding area of London Fields boasts plenty of cafes, restaurants, and local shops. So, you can easily grab a coffee or a snack before embarking on your journey. As for staying connected, public Wi-Fi access is available, enabling you to effectively plan your day or simply unwind.
The station’s strategic location means excellent connections with various modes of transport. For those relying on buses, Transport for London buses operate directly from outside the station, ensuring seamless connections to major locations such as Liverpool Street via bus stop LA on Mare Street. Rail replacement services are also conveniently within reach, operating from these stops and ensuring continuity of travel even during maintenance periods.
Despite the lack of car parking facilities, London Fields offers accessible transport options for navigating the city. While cycling enthusiasts might be disappointed by the absence of cycle hire services and bike storage, the surrounding neighborhood is pedestrian-friendly and full of character.
